**Explanation of the Poetry – "A Jatt's Only Love"**
This is a passionate declaration of love Poetry, where the singer expresses deep admiration and commitment to his beloved. The lyrics convey his devotion, emphasizing that from head to toe, he belongs to her entirely. He proudly states that no one else can capture his heart the way she does.
The song highlights the beauty of the woman, with the singer repeatedly asking her not to question how stunning she looks. He insists that she is unique and that a Jatt (a strong, proud Punjabi man) would never settle for anything less than extraordinary. Her charm and simplicity captivate him, making her his ultimate choice.
Another key theme in the song is fate versus personal determination. The singer dismisses the idea of relying on destiny or luck, asserting that a true Jatt carves his own path. He is confident that no force, not even fate itself, can take his love away from him. This showcases his unwavering commitment to their relationship.
The lyrics also describe the woman’s natural beauty, comparing her to a delicate doll. The singer assures her that she doesn’t need extravagant clothes or accessories to impress him—her simplicity and grace are more than enough. No amount of colorful traditional scarves (phulkariyan) can compare to her elegance.
In the latter part of the song, the singer makes a heartfelt promise to protect her from pain. His love for her is so immense that he vows to always keep her safe and cherished. He reassures her that she has the right to stand by his side, emphasizing her special place in his life. He also makes it clear that no one else can come as close to him as she does.
Overall, this song is a powerful expression of love, loyalty, and admiration. It celebrates the idea that true love is not just about physical beauty but also about emotional connection and respect. The singer’s confidence, pride, and affectionate words make this song a beautiful representation of Punjabi romance.
